Crystal Palace v Aston Villa: FA Cup semi-final – live ○ found 2025 › Apr › 26 (Sat) @ 15:25 UTC a story from The Guardian ⚠️ › International Crystal ■■■ Palace ■■■ Aston Villa ■■■ Wembley ■■■ Football Daily ■■ Scott ■■ Victorian ■■ Edwardian ■■ Compare ■■ Crystal Palace ■■■ Villa ■■ Fifties ■■ preview sentiment